Entscheidungsbaum: Grundlage, Anwendung und Praxiswissen für klare Entscheidungen

Einführung in den Entscheidungsbaum

Ein Entscheidungsbaum ist eine visuell klare und logische Struktur, mit der komplexe Entscheidungsprozesse in überschaubare Schritte zerlegt werden. In der Praxis, ob im Unternehmen, in der Wissenschaft oder im Alltag, dient der Entscheidungsbaum als Werkzeug zur systematischen Abwägung von Optionen. Durch die Abbildung von Fragen in aufteilbaren Ebenen lässt sich eine komplexe Entscheidung nachvollziehbar, transparent und reproduzierbar gestalten. Der Begriff Entscheidungsbaum, oder in der nominativ-klassischen Schreibweise Entscheidungsbaum, bezeichnet eine Baumstruktur, in der jeder Knoten eine Frage oder Eigenschaft repräsentiert und jeder Pfad zu einem Ergebnis oder einer Klasse führt. Im Kern steht die Idee: Wenn bestimmte Bedingungen erfüllt sind, folgt ein spezifischer Ast, andernfalls ein alternativer Ast. Diese Logik macht den Entscheidungsbaum zu einem bevorzugten Modell, wenn Interpretierbarkeit eine zentrale Rolle spielt.

Wichtig ist, dass der Entscheidungsbaum in vielen Varianten auftreten kann. Von einfachen Entscheidungsbäumen bis hin zu komplexen ensembles wie Random Forest oder Gradient Boosting. In jedem Fall bleibt das Grundprinzip erhalten: Knoten, Äste, Entscheidungen, Blätter. Die Kunst besteht darin, den Baum so zu gestalten, dass er die Realität möglichst treffend abbildet, ohne dabei zu übermäßigem Overfitting zu neigen. Lesen Sie weiter, um zu verstehen, wie dieser Mechanismus funktioniert, welche Typen es gibt und wie man ihn praktisch einsetzt.

Was ist ein Entscheidungsbaum? Definition und Konzepte

Der Entscheidungsbaum ist eine graphische Darstellung der Abhängigkeiten zwischen Merkmalen und Zielgrößen. In der einfachsten Form besteht er aus drei Elementen: Wurzelknoten, Entscheidungs-/Frageknoten und Blattknoten. Der Wurzelknoten markiert die erste Frage, der Ablauf folgt entlang der Äste, bis das Blatt eine Klassen- oder Regressionsvorhersage liefert. Diese Struktur eignet sich besonders gut, um Ursache-Wirkungs-Beziehungen sichtbar zu machen und Entscheidungen nachvollziehbar zu dokumentieren.

In der Welt der statistischen Lernverfahren wird der Entscheidungsbaum oft als klares,透明es Modell beschrieben, dessen Entscheidungen sich auditieren lassen. Die Vorteile liegen in der Interpretierbarkeit, in der Transparenz der Regeln und in der Fähigkeit, sowohl kategoriale als auch numerische Merkmale zu berücksichtigen. Allerdings gilt ebenso: Ein einzelner Entscheidungsbaum kann anfällig für Datenrauschen und Overfitting sein, weshalb in vielen Fällen der Einsatz von Ensemble-Methoden sinnvoll ist, um robuste Vorhersagen zu erzielen. Dennoch bleibt der Entscheidungsbaum eine hervorragende Grundlage für die explorative Analyse, das Erkennen von Muster und das Skizzieren von Handlungsoptionen.

Typen und Varianten des Entscheidungsbaums

Standard-Entscheidungsbäume: CART, ID3, C4.5

Zu den klassischen Varianten gehören CART (Classification and Regression Trees), ID3 (Iterative Dichotomiser 3) und C4.5. CART arbeitet sowohl mit Klassifikations- als auch mit Regressionsaufgaben und nutzt häufig Gini- oder Entropie-Kriterien, um Splits zu wählen. ID3 und C4.5 setzen auf Entropie bzw. Informationsgewinn und sind besonders in der explorativen Datenanalyse beliebt. Die Wahl des Algorithmus beeinflusst die Baumstruktur, die Komplexität und die Interpretierbarkeit der Ergebnisse. Im Entscheidungsbaum entstehen dadurch klare Entscheidungsregeln, die sich leicht kommunizieren lassen.

Random Forest und Gradient Boosting: Ensemble-Ansätze

Wenn die Leistungsfähigkeit eines einzelnen Baums nicht mehr ausreicht, kommen Ensemble-Methoden zum Einsatz. Ein Random Forest erzeugt eine Vielzahl von Entscheidungsbäumen, deren Vorhersagen aggregiert werden, um Stabilität und Genauigkeit zu erhöhen. Gradient Boosting baut schrittweise neue Bäume auf den Fehlern der vorherigen Bäume auf, optimiert so die Gesamtleistung und mindert Überanpassung. In beiden Fällen erhält man robuste Modelle, die wesentlich bessere Generalisierung aufweisen als ein einzelner Entscheidungsbaum. Für Leserinnen und Leser, die Transparenz bewahren möchten, bleibt die Struktur dennoch nachvollziehbar: Jede Teilung beruht auf messbaren Kriterien, nur die Gesamtkomplexität steigt durch die Menge der Bäume.

Aufbau eines Entscheidungsbaums: Knoten, Blätter und Regeln

Der Entscheidungsbaum besteht aus mehreren Bausteinen: Wurzel, innere Knoten, Blätter und die Kanten (Äste). An jedem inneren Knoten befindet sich eine Entscheidungsregel, die auf einem Merkmalswert oder einer Bedingung basiert. Die Pfade führen schrittweise zu den Blattknoten, die eine Vorhersage oder eine Entscheidung darstellen. Wichtige Begriffe im Überblick:

  • Wurzelknoten: Der Startpunkt des Baums, hier beginnt die Abfrage.
  • Entscheidungsknoten: Knoten, an dem eine Bedingung geprüft wird (z. B. Merkmalswert > Schwellenwert).
  • Blätter: Endknoten, die das Ergebnis liefern (z. B. Klasse oder Regressionswert).
  • Split-Kriterium: Maß, nach dem der beste Pfad gewählt wird (Gini, Entropie, SSE, etc.).
  • Pruning: Verfahren zum Beschneiden des Baums, um Überanpassung zu verhindern.

Die Kunst des Entscheidungsbaums liegt darin, sinnvolle Splits zu finden, die relevante Muster in den Daten widerspiegeln, ohne sich in unwesentlichen Details zu verlieren. Dabei helfen Metriken wie Informationsgewinn oder Gini-Reduktion, die den Wert eines Splits quantifizieren. In der Praxis gilt: Je eindeutiger die Trennungen, desto smaller und interpretierbarer wird der Baum. Gleichzeitig muss die Generalisierung berücksichtigt werden, um neue Daten zuverlässig zu behandeln.

Wie man einen Entscheidungsbaum erstellt: Schritt-für-Schritt-Anleitung

Schritt 1: Ziel definieren und Daten vorbereiten

Definieren Sie klar, welche Frage der Entscheidungsbaum beantworten soll. Sammeln Sie relevante Merkmale, prüfen Sie die Datenqualität und behandeln Sie fehlende Werte sinnvoll. Saubere, gut beschriftete Daten bilden die Grundlage für einen leistungsfähigen Entscheidungsbaum. Je besser die Daten, desto präziser die resultierenden Regeln.

Schritt 2: Merkmale auswählen und transformieren

Entscheidungsbäume können sowohl nominale als auch numerische Merkmale verwenden. Manchmal lohnt es sich, Merkmale zu transformieren oder zu kombinieren (Feature Engineering), z. B. durch das Erzeugen von Interaktionen oder das Aufteilen kontinuierlicher Merkmale in Klassen. Eine übermäßige Merkmalsanzahl kann den Baum unübersichtlich machen – hier hilft eine sinnvolle Reduktion.

Schritt 3: Algorithmus und Split-Kriterien wählen

Wählen Sie je nach Aufgabe CART, ID3, C4.5 oder andere Methoden. Bestimmen Sie das Split-Kriterium (Gini, Informationsgewinn, SSE) und legen Sie maximale Baumtiefe, minimale Blattgröße und andere Hyperparameter fest. Diese Entscheidungen beeinflussen die Komplexität des Baums stark.

Schritt 4: Baum wachsen lassen und prüfen

Der Baum wächst, indem wiederkehrend der beste Split ausgewählt wird. Beobachten Sie frühzeitig, ob der Baum zu viel erklärt oder zu wenig differenziert. Cross-Validation dient hier als hilfreiches Instrument, um die Verallgemeinerungsfähigkeit zu testen. Grafische Darstellungen helfen, das Vorgehen nachzuvollziehen.

Schritt 5: Pruning und Optimierung

Pruning schneidet überflüssige Äste ab, um die Komplexität zu reduzieren und Overfitting zu vermeiden. Unterschiedliche Pruning-Strategien gibt es, etwa cost-complexity pruning oder post-pruning. Ziel ist eine gute Balance zwischen Vorhersagegenauigkeit und Interpretierbarkeit.

Schritt 6: Validierung und Interpretation

Validieren Sie den Baum auf separaten Datensätzen. Nutzen Sie Kennzahlen wie Genauigkeit, Präzision, Recall, F1-Score oder RMSE, je nach Aufgabenstellung. Interpretierbarkeit bleibt oft der Schlüsselvorteil des Entscheidungsbaums: Die gesammelten Regeln lassen sich verständlich erklären und kommunizieren.

Anwendungen des Entscheidungsbaums in der Praxis

Datenschutz und Compliance

Beim Entscheidungsbaum spielt Transparenz eine zentrale Rolle. In sensiblen Bereichen wie Datenschutz oder Compliance führen klare Entscheidungsregeln zu nachvollziehbaren Entscheidungen. Unternehmen profitieren von auditierbaren Modellen, die regulatorische Anforderungen unterstützen. Der Entscheidungsbaum ermöglicht eine nachvollziehbare Dokumentation der Entscheidungswege.

Finanzen und Kreditvergabe

Im Kredit- und Risikomanagement werden Entscheidungsbäume genutzt, um Kreditwürdigkeit oder Ausfallrisiken abzuschätzen. Durch strukturierte Kriterien wie Einkommen, Schulden, Beschäftigungsdauer und Kredithistorie entsteht ein nachvollziehbarer Entscheidungsprozess. Ensemble-Methoden erhöhen die Stabilität, doch auch hier bleibt die Interpretierbarkeit ein wichtiger Vorteil des Baums.

Marketing und Kundenanalyse

Im Marketing helfen Entscheidungsbäume bei der Segmentierung, der Zielgruppenauswahl und der Optimierung von Kampagnen. Durch klare Entscheidungsregeln lässt sich ableiten, welche Kundensegmente mit bestimmten Maßnahmen am besten erreicht werden. Die Ergebnisse lassen sich verständlich kommunizieren und in Strategien übersetzen.

Medizin und Gesundheitswesen

In der klinischen Entscheidungsfindung unterstützen Entscheidungsbäume bei der Diagnoseunterstützung oder Therapieempfehlungen. Die klare Logik jedes Schritts erleichtert die Kommunikation mit Patientinnen und Patienten sowie mit anderen Fachdisziplinen. Dabei ist die Validierung mit echten klinischen Daten essenziell, um Sicherheit und Wirksamkeit zu garantieren.

Vorteile, Grenzen und Best Practices

Vorteile:

  • Hohe Interpretierbarkeit und Transparenz der Entscheidungsregeln.
  • Geringer Vorwissenbedarf bei der Nutzung; intuitive Visualisierung.
  • Flexibilität bei der Verarbeitung unterschiedlicher Merkmale.

Herausforderungen und Grenzen:

  • Anfälligkeit für Overfitting bei komplexen Bäumen ohne ausreichende Datensätze.
  • Empfindlichkeit gegenüber kleinen Datenänderungen, die zu unterschiedlichen Splits führen können.
  • Bei rein numerischen Problemen kann ein einzelner Baum weniger robust sein als Ensemble-Methoden.

Best Practices:

  • Nutzen Sie Pruning, um Überanpassung zu vermeiden.
  • Setzen Sie sinnvolle Hyperparameter wie maximale Baumtiefe, minimale Blattgröße.
  • Beachten Sie das Bias- und Varianz-Dilemma und prüfen Sie alternative Modelle oder Ensembles bei Bedarf.
  • Dokumentieren Sie die Entscheidungsregeln klar, um Vertrauen zu schaffen.

Praxisbeispiel: Kreditwürdigkeitsanalyse mit einem Entscheidungsbaum

Stellen Sie sich vor, eine Bank möchte anhand weniger Merkmale die Kreditwürdigkeit einer Person einschätzen. Merkmale könnten Alter, Einkommen, Beschäftigungsdauer, vorhandene Schulden und bisherige Kreditnutzung sein. Der Entscheidungsbaum wird so aufgebaut, dass er Fragen wie: „Ist das Einkommen größer als 3000 CHF pro Monat?“ oder „Ist die Beschäftigungsdauer länger als 2 Jahre?“ auf verschiedenen Ebenen abbildet. Aus diesen Entscheidungen ergibt sich eine Blattklasse wie „Kredit genehmigen“ oder „Kredit ablehnen“ sowie ggf. eine Risikoeinschätzung. Ein solcher Entscheidungsbaum liefert dem Risk-Manager eine klare Begründung, warum eine Entscheidung getroffen wurde, und lässt sich leicht kommunizieren. Gleichzeitig kann das Modell durch Cross-Validation und Pruning robust gemacht werden, sodass es besser generalisiert und weniger anfällig gegen ungewöhnliche Fälle ist.

Durch den Einsatz eines Ensembles, zum Beispiel eines Random Forest, lässt sich die Genauigkeit erhöhen, während die Interpretierbarkeit pro Baum erhalten bleibt. In der Praxis ist oft ein Mix sinnvoll: Ein übersichtlicher Entscheidungsbaum für die Kommunikation gegenüber Stakeholdern, ergänzt durch ein robustes Ensemble-Modell für präzise Vorhersagen im Hintergrund.

Praktische Tipps für bessere Ergebnisse mit dem Entscheidungsbaum

Interpretierbarkeit priorisieren

Wenn das Ziel Klarheit ist, achten Sie darauf, dass der Baum nicht unnötig komplex wird. Begrenzen Sie die maximale Baumtiefe und die minimale Blattgröße, um handhabbare Regeln zu behalten. Visualisieren Sie den Baum, damit Fachkollegen die Logik nachvollziehen können.

Datengüte sicherstellen

Saubere, gut vorbereitete Daten verbessern die Qualität des Entscheidungsbaums erheblich. Entfernen Sie Rauschen, behandeln Sie fehlende Werte sorgfältig und standardisieren Sie Merkmale, wenn nötig. Gute Daten sind der wichtigste Treiber für zuverlässige Entscheidungen.

Ausgewogene Datensätze nutzen

Ungleichgewicht bei Klassen kann zu Baumsplits führen, die eine Dominanz einer Klasse erkennen lassen. Nutzen Sie Techniken wie Ober- oder Unterabtastung oder gewichtete Fehler, um ein ausgewogenes Lernverhalten zu erreichen.

Validierung ernst nehmen

Verlassen Sie sich nicht nur auf Trainingsleistung. Verwenden Sie Cross-Validation, Bootstrapping oder separate Testdaten, um die Generalisierung zu prüfen. Gute Modelle zeigen konsistente Ergebnisse über verschiedene Stichproben hinweg.

Häufige Begriffe rund um den Entscheidungsbaum

Entscheidungsbaum ist eng verbunden mit verwandten Konzepten wie Entscheidungsregelbaum, Entscheidungsdiagramm und Baumstruktur. In der Praxis wird oft von Entscheidungsbaum-Modellen gesprochen, wenn sowohl Klassifikation als auch Regression gemeint ist. Die richtige Begriffsverwendung erleichtert die interne Kommunikation und verhindert Missverständnisse.

Zusammenfassung: Warum der Entscheidungsbaum sinnvoll bleibt

Der Entscheidungsbaum bietet eine einzigartige Kombination aus Transparenz, Nachvollziehbarkeit und Anwendbarkeit über verschiedene Domänen hinweg. Ob als eigenständiges Modell oder als Teil eines größeren Ensemble-Ansatzes, der Entscheidungsbaum ermöglicht es, komplexe Entscheidungen in klare, verständliche Schritte zu zerlegen. Die einfache Visualisierung unterstützt Stakeholder-Kommunikation, während solide Validierung und sinnvolles Pruning die Robustheit sichern. Wer Wert auf interpretierbare Ergebnisse legt, trifft mit dem Entscheidungsbaum eine gute Wahl; wer maximale Genauigkeit benötigt, ergänzt das Modell oft durch ensemblebasierte Strategien. In jedem Fall bleibt der Entscheidungsbaum ein bewährtes Werkzeug im Werkzeugkasten moderner Datenanalyse und Entscheidungsunterstützung.

Entscheidungsbaum: Grundlage, Anwendung und Praxiswissen für klare Entscheidungen Einführung in den Entscheidungsbaum Ein Entscheidungsbaum ist eine visuell klare und logische […]